Comprehending SCHD
Before diving into the annual dividend estimation, let's briefly discuss what SCHD is. The Schwab U.S. Dividend Equity ETF is engineered to track the efficiency of the Dow Jones U.S. Dividend 100 Index. It consists primarily of high dividend yielding U.S. stocks that have a record of regularly paying dividends. SCHD intends to supply a high level of income while also providing chances for capital appreciation.

Approximating your annual dividends from schd dividend distribution involves inputting a couple of variables into a dividend calculator. The main variables usually include:
Number of shares owned: The total SCHD shares you own.Existing dividend per share: The newest declared dividend.Dividend frequency: Typically, dividends for SCHD are paid quarterly.Formula for Annual Dividend Calculation
The formula to calculate your annual dividends is reasonably straightforward:

[\ text Annual Dividends = \ text Number of Shares Owned \ times \ text Dividends per Share \ times \ text Dividend Frequency]Example Calculation
Let's take a look at the annual dividends utilizing an example. Suppose an investor owns 100 shares of SCHD and the most recent dividend per share is ₤ 1.25. The dividend is dispersed quarterly (4 times a year).
SpecificationValueNumber of Shares Owned100Current Dividend per Share₤ 1.25Dividend Frequency (per year)4
Utilizing our formula, we can calculate:

[\ text Annual Dividends = 100 \ times 1.25 \ times 4 = 500]
In this case, the financier would get ₤ 500 in annual dividends from owning 100 shares of SCHD.
The Importance of Reinvesting Dividends
While receiving dividend payments is beneficial, think about reinvesting them through a Dividend Reinvestment Plan (DRIP). This strategy allows investors to purchase additional shares of SCHD utilizing the dividends got, possibly intensifying their returns in time.
